- BusinessObjects TM Data Quality XI 3.0/3.1 enables you to parse, cleanse, standardize, consolidate, and enhance records.
- In this two-day course, you will learn about cleansing address and firm data, and matching and consolidating records.
- As a business benefit, by being able to create efficient data quality projects, you can use the transformed data to help improve operational and supply chain efficiencies, enhance customer relationships, create new revenue opportunities, and optimize return on investment from enterprise applications.
This course is designed for individuals responsible for implementing, administering, and managing data quality projects.
Working with Data Quality Transforms
- Describe the data quality framework
- Define the processes of parsing, standardizing, cleansing, enhancing, matching, and consolidating data
- Describe the available Data Quality transforms
- Describe how to use the Transform Editor to configure Data Quality transforms
Cleansing Address Data
- Explain the benefits of address cleansing
- Identify the supported formats and types of address data
- Describe the Address Cleanse transforms in Data Quality
- Define how to handle address data from different countries
- Configure an Address Cleanse transform
- Define how to cleanse transactional data
Cleansing Name, Firm, and Product Data
- Explain the benefits of data cleansing
- Describe the Data Cleanse transforms in Data Quality
- Define how to handle types of name and firm data
- Configure a Data Cleanse transform
- Define the purpose of parsing dictionaries
- Customize dictionary entries
- Set up Universal Data Cleanse for operational data
Matching and Consolidating Records
- Select a matching strategy
- Understand match sets, match levels, match criteria, and break groups
- Use the Match Wizard to configure the Match transform
- Describe matching methods
- Modify the Match transform using the Match Editor
- Configure post-match processing operations
- Understand householding and associative matching
To be successful, you must have working knowledge of: Windows conventions Basic database concepts
